> In that case, you're better off using Ghost 2002's explorer and
> chop a image up and then record to CDR's. Create the image by imaging the
> HD to a file on the HD first. As for Prassi. Prassi = Sony's CD Software
> division that got sold to Veritas. The RecordNow, RecordMax, and other
> software that comes with HP Drives is what Stuart is referring to.

> > > I've been using "Prassi Primo DVD" with both
> > > a firewire connected Pioneer DVD-R and with an
> > > older IBM CD-R/RW in my A21p. Prassi shipped with
> > > the DVD-R and they update it for new drives every
> > > so often. It has worked very well for me for both
> > > 4.7 GB DVD-R and with CD-R. I have not tried CD-RW.
> > >
> > > Veritas bought Prassi (from what I can determine)
> > > so if Veritas offers some CD-R/RS and/or DVD
> > > recording software I might try that.
> > >
> > > If you don't mind a command line interface and
> > > doing a two step burn, the Win32 version of
> > > cdrecord (freeware) works fine with my IBM drive.
> > > You build a CD image and then burn it (two programs).
> > >
> > > Up side is that it can create a CD with both Joliet
> > > (MS specific long filenames on CD) and RockRidge
> > > extensions so long filenames on the CD can be
> > > read by both UNIX (Solaris in my case but most
> > > likely also Linux) and Windows. A very robust
> > > and useful program. There are various UNIX
> > > versions of cdrecord also which can again write
> > > the dual use CDs. The web site can be a bit
> > > confusing but here it is:

> > > As a side note, I had nothing but trouble some time
> > > back with Roxio 5.?. Especially if I had a CF card
> > > (in a PC Card adapter) plugged in (infinite reboot
> > > cycle, etc). We are having "features" with a desktop
> > > with a Cardbus/PCMCIA card adpater and Roxio - I
> > > really wonder if Adaptec (Roxio) does full compatibility
> > > testing with a variety of hardware. Prassi doesn't
> > > have the problems with that machine (runs Win2000).
